GI DESIGN TO EC7

EC7 has been here for a decade now and its use in industry is becoming more widespread all the time.  The 2015 update of the Code of Practice for Ground Investigations, BS5930, says GI’s ‘should’ follow the guidance in EC7 on GI quantum.  This coupled with the adoption of EC7 in Building Regulations and NHBC standards means that GI design is potentially set for some significant changes. To help the industry prepare, we are running again our intensive half day course that aims to address the likely impact of EC7 on ground investigation design.  It will be taught against a background introduction to design practice to EC7, and the requirements for ground characterisation and parametric assessment in particular.  The majority of the course will focus on EC7 design requirements for GI’s, including a design exercise to examine the scale of changes that could be required. The course will introduce also changes to logging and reporting requirements to suit EC7. BESPOKE GEOLOGY COURSE COMMISSIONED

We are pleased to announce that we recently delivered a bespoke course on engineering geology for a large consultancy.  Targeted at civil engineering graduates, the course focused on developing their understanding of geology and its significance in geotechnical engineering.  It was delivered in an interactive, workshops style and covered aspects such as:
  • fundamental geological concepts
  • understanding geological maps
  • practical exercises on developing ground models and cross sections
  • an overview of the geology of the British Isles
  • hazards and risks presented by the major geological units in the UK.
